Todd’s residency is at 3904 Lake Front Cir #101, Virginia Bch, Va 23452. Public records show Virginia Beach, Whitesboro and Sherburne as cities Todd also stayed in. Todd's birth year is 1975. This year Todd celebrated his 49 birthday. We have found 4 possible relatives of Todd: Betsy Sue Duerheimer, Brian Edward Duerheimer, Geraldine M Duerheimer and one other person. Todd has listed phone number: (757) 498-8441.